Dirt leveling services involve the process of grading and smoothing out uneven or disturbed soil surfaces on residential or commercial properties. This work typically includes removing excess dirt, filling in low spots, and creating a flat, even surface suitable for lawns, gardens, driveways, or other landscaping projects. Skilled service providers use specialized equipment to ensure the soil is properly contoured, helping to establish a stable foundation for future landscaping or construction work. Proper dirt leveling not only improves the appearance of a property but also prepares the ground for planting, paving, or building projects.
One of the primary problems dirt leveling services address is poor drainage caused by uneven terrain. When the ground is sloped or irregular, water can pool in certain areas, leading to potential flooding, soil erosion, or damage to landscaping features. Additionally, uneven soil can create tripping hazards or make it difficult to mow or maintain lawns. Service providers can correct these issues by regrading the land, ensuring water flows away from structures and reducing the risk of water damage. This work can also help prevent soil erosion and stabilize loose or shifting ground, making outdoor spaces safer and more functional.

The overview below groups typical Dirt Leveling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Spring Hill, TN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or dirt leveling projects in Spring Hill, TN range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s, such as smoothing small uneven areas, fall within this middle range, depending on the size and complexity.
Medium-Scale Projects - Larger, more involved dirt leveling services often cost between $600-$1,500. These projects usually include leveling larger sections of land or preparing areas for landscaping, with fewer jobs reaching the higher end of this range.
Full Yard or Large Area Leveling - For extensive dirt leveling across entire yards or large properties, local contractors may charge $1,500-$3,500. Such projects are less common and can vary based on land size and site conditions.
Complete Site Preparation or Major Overhaul - Complex or extensive dirt leveling projects, such as preparing a site for construction, can exceed $3,500 and reach $5,000+ in some cases. These are typically larger, more intricate jobs that require significant effort and resources.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
